    In the past few weeks I’ve read several articles on the approval and distribution of both Ruzurgi and Firdapse for LEMS patients in Canada. What a wonderful thing! Going back to my diagnosis in January, 2018, there was no Firdapse or Ruzurgi available. I was hearing about this drug called 3,4 DAP (3,4 diaminopyradine) on Facebook LEMS groups which I’d joined. They were talking about how wonderful it was for their Lambert-Eaton. But…further checking and it wasn’t actually available here in the U.S. I soon learned there was one drug company, Jacobus Pharmaceuticals, who was getting 3,4 DAP to patients as part of a trial. Calling them, I learned there was lots of paperwork, but it was doable. Try as I might, I couldn’t get my neurologist off high-center to get that done. At the time I was unaware another drug company also was in trials with a variation of the same medication, amifampridine phosphate. In June, 2018, my friend Dawn, wrangled me an invitation to a Catalyst Pharmaceuticals meeting in August, literally 10 minutes from where I live in DFW. How fortuitous! Out of those meetings I managed to get myself in their Expanded Release Program, getting amifampridine for the first time in October! The so called “miracle drug” by some, was now in my hands. You can see how easy that was, right? NOT.
    And that’s the great thing I’m reading about now, the easier access to a great meditation for all LEMS patients, with the approval of both the FDA and Health Canada, of both Firdapse and Ruzurgi. At least in my case, it couldn’t have come at a better time.
